For some reason, there's been a lot of interest in having E1e heads modded. I've been getting lots of PM's and emails with the same questions, so I'll post the answers here.

It appears that the changes that came about in the new KL1 do not spell the death of having a kick a$$ E1e mod. Now that the Aleph LE is available to use, I can mod the stock E1e head to accept an Aleph LE and fit an SO17XA reflector in the head. The ecan/esink mod using the stock reflector doesn't even come close to the mod using the Aleph LE, in terms of performance. This mod is also more desireable to having a modded KL1, in the sense that the light will maintain its small E1e size, and will look stock.

The mod would be similar to the one shown in the link below, but I would use the IMS reflector instead of the modded 27mm reflector to keep costs down and maintain the stock look of the E1e.
